==Personal life== [[File:Colin Baker January 2015.jpg|thumb|Baker at the 2015 Magic City Comic Con]] Baker's first wife was actress [[Liza Goddard]] who had appeared with him in the TV series ''The Brothers''. Their marriage lasted 18 months and ended in divorce.<ref>{{cite news |url=https://www.telegraph.co.uk/finance/personalfinance/fameandfortune/9960062/Actress-Liza-Goddard-Money-is-made-to-be-spent.html |title=Actress Liza Goddard: 'Money is made to be spent' |newspaper=[[The Daily Telegraph]] |first=Toby |last=Walne |date=1 April 2013 |at=Marrying Dr Who and a glam rock star β a financially astute move? }}</ref> With his second wife, Marion Wyatt, an actress, whom he married in 1982, Baker has four daughters: Lucy, Bindy (an accomplished singer), Lalla and Rosie.<ref>{{cite web |url=https://colinbaker.webs.com/biog.html |title=Biography |work=Colin Baker Online |access-date=9 February 2022}}</ref> They also had a son, Jack, who died of [[sudden infant death syndrome]].<ref>{{cite web |url=http://news.bbc.co.uk/1/hi/health/628670.stm |title=Visits 'would help prevent deaths' |date=2 February 2000 |work=BBC News}}</ref><ref>{{cite web |url=https://www.bbc.co.uk/threecounties/theatre/2002/12/colin_baker.shtml |date=24 September 2014 |title=Colin's Major role |work=[[BBC Three Counties Radio]] |access-date=4 December 2015}}</ref> His wife and daughters appeared in ''The Five(ish) Doctors Reboot'' as themselves. Baker is a friend of American writer [[Stephen R. Donaldson]], who dedicated his 1991 novel ''[[Forbidden Knowledge]]'' to him.<ref>{{cite web |url=http://www.stephenrdonaldson.net/fromtheauthor/gi_view.php?Year=2004&Month=08&NewWindow=yes&Filter=&all=&any=&none= |title=Gradual Interview |work=stephendonaldson.net |last=Donaldson |first=Stephen R.|author-link=Stephen R. Donaldson |date=August 2004 |access-date=29 January 2014}}</ref> Baker is a critic of [[fox hunting]] and was among more than 20 high-profile people who signed a letter to members of parliament in 2015 to oppose [[Conservative Party (UK)|Conservative]] prime minister [[David Cameron]]'s plan to amend the [[Hunting Act 2004]].<ref>{{cite news |url=http://news.stv.tv/scotland-decides/news/1324609-snp-to-vote-against-tories-on-fox-hunting-ban-in-england-and-wales/ |title=SNP to vote against Tories on fox hunting ban in England and Wales |work=STV |date=13 July 2015 |access-date=17 July 2015 |url-status=dead |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20150715203740/http://news.stv.tv/scotland-decides/news/1324609-snp-to-vote-against-tories-on-fox-hunting-ban-in-england-and-wales/ |archive-date=15 July 2015 |df=dmy }}</ref>
